Recently it was announced that Star Wars: The Force Unleashed has become the fastest selling Star Wars game of all time, as 1.5 million copies had been sold in less than a week worldwide. Due to the immense succes of this game, additional copies have to get made and distributed to meet worldwide demand. That’s saying something if you consider the fact that initially there had already been made available more than 4 million copies by LucasArts. But the good news doesn’t stop here…

It was announced recently that there are two major updates coming for The Force Unleashed! The first update will include some extra costumes for you to choose from, enabling you to control either Ki-Adi-Mundi, Kit Fisto, Obi-Wan Kenobi or Luke Skywalker! Keep in mind that you’re still playing with- and controlling the basic Apprentice character model though.

ki-adi-mundi.jpg kit-fisto.jpg

Ki-Adi-Mundi and Kit Fisto at your service!

 

The other update will include a new single player mission which will take place in the Jedi Temple on Coruscant, where the Apprentice goes in search for more information about his father. Unfortunately there are no release dates or pricing details available at the moment yet. I hope both updates will be released soon though, as I’m nearly at the end of this great game!
